Group:
I have been searching without success in the group archive and in the cisco
web-site an example or explanation for the flag X - Proxy Join Timer
Running.
This is because in the following scenario with three routers: R2 (hub), R5
and R6 (spoken) with a source in (R5) and a group member in the LAN
interface of (R6), the multicast traffic just flows for a period of time and
then it4s pruned (I4m using mrm to generate traffic but I don4t stop it to
justify the prunning). I think the flag X could be the problem.
